What is Episcopal Chaplains Pray?
Episcopal Chaplains Pray is an opportunity for Episcopal chaplains and CPE educators to gather regularly to connect through virtual noonday prayer and a brief time of fellowship.
Which chaplains are included?
All chaplains and CPE educators affiliated with The Episcopal Church are welcome to attend. This includes Episcopal chaplains and CPE educators who are:
Active, retired, or students
Endorsed or not
Board-certified or not
Lay or ordained
Federal (under the Bishop Suffragan for the Armed Forces and Federal Ministries)
Who serve in any context, e.g., healthcare, corrections, first responders, etc.
Why does it exist?
Episcopal Chaplains Pray is an opportunity for any chaplain or CPE educator of the Episcopal Church to meet with other Episcopal chaplains and CPE educators for a time of prayer and fellowship on a regular basis.

What does it look like?

We pray together using the a variety of Orders of Service from Anglican and Episcopal Prayer Books.
After Noonday prayer concludes, we spend time connecting with one another. Participants are welcome to come and go as they are able.
